Prof. Frederik (Fred) Truyen teaches Online Publishing and Digital Cultural Heritage in the Arts Faculty of KU Leuven. He is a member of the Cultural Studies Research Group. He works mostly on the development of digital heritage collections, in particular photographic collections.

The new home of the Common European Data Space for Cultural Heritage is Online!
"Led by the Europeana Initiative, the data space empowers cultural heritage institutions and European Union Member States to embrace and drive digital transformation. As one of the 14 interoperable common European data spaces funded through the DIGITAL Europe Programme, it is central to Europe’s ambition of building a thriving, data-driven society."

Join us in February for the AI4Culture Hackathon that will take place on February 12 (introduction, group formation) and from February 18 to 20 (group work), in Leuven. These are digital tools for the heritage sector and research communities. You will be able to work with a large number of tools and datasets developed and/or selected by the Digital Europe funded project AI4Culture.

Face/Surface. Metamorphosis of colonial perspectives is a capsule collection of twelve colonial-era photographs recontextualised.
